For any 2 litre C-HR owners looking to retrofit a spare here's the parts I used as recommended by Toyota UK for my vehicle VIN.
Please double check these part numbers are suitable for your own vehicle VIN with your Toyota dealer parts department before ordering!

09111-F4011/Jack SU

09113-F4010 Handle Pantogr

09150-F4010 Wrench Hub Nut

51931-02040 Carrier Spare

64778-F4050 Protector Spar

64429-F4010 Box Luggage RO

64995-F4070 Box Deck Floor

64716-F4050-C0 Cover Deck Trim

42600-F4211 Wheel A

Total retail price was £350.56 including the VAT & takes less then 20 minutes to fit, you just need a 10mm socket to remove the 2 bolts that secure the rear luggage nut D rings to replace a trim panel.

Found another surprising feature today.

The rear wiper has both intermittent wipe & continuous wipe depending on how far round you twist the end of the wiper stalk.
1st click = intermittent & 2nd click = continuous.

First time I've driven a vehicle that actually gives the driver the choice for the rear wiper frequency.

Manoeuvring in to a parking space earlier at the supermarket, a pedestrian I had all ready spotted to my left started to walk towards to cross behind the car & the RCTA system picked them up & warned me.

First the left side mirror started flashing & as they carried on walking the right side mirror joined in to - warning beep goes nuts as well

I'm impressed how good the BSM & RCTA systems are on the C-HR.
 
#68 ·
Just noticed if your in reverse & the RCTA activates it also flashes a warning on the infotainment screen.

I had selected reverse, I was watching the screen as backing on to the drive, beep beep beep with orange >>> symbols on the right side of the screen, sure enough a car had approached from the right.

Thats the older MMI screen in your photo

New ones, since late April, early May only have one dial on the left side and no physical buttons. Plus live traffic, better voice activation and a few other tweaks
